FAQ

How Do I Choose The Right Filter?

Start by confirming the exact part number or fitment for your make, model and year and compare it to the seller’s compatibility info. Verify fitment rather than relying on images, because dimensions and air box shapes vary and some filters sit very tight.

Decide whether your priority is maximum filtration for engine protection or increased airflow for mild performance gains, since disposable high-pleat paper filters favor particle capture while washable performance elements prioritize airflow. Finally, check seal quality and media construction so you get a proper seal against water and debris in the intake.

Will A Performance Filter Improve Power Or Economy?

You may notice a small improvement in throttle response or engine breathing, especially on older or restricted engines, but large horsepower jumps are unlikely without additional tuning. Many high-flow filters reduce intake restriction and can make the engine feel more responsive, yet real-world fuel economy changes depend on driving style and vehicle tuning. If you choose a reusable or oiled element, foll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ully to avoid over-oiling or letting excess contaminants through the intake.

How Often Should I Replace Or Clean The Filter?

Check the filter visually at every oil change and replace or service it when you see heavy dirt, oil or restricted pleats; that’s a simple habit that prevents performance loss and engine wear. Disposable paper filters typically follow manufacturer intervals or appear dirty sooner in dusty conditions, while washable filters should be cleaned, allowed to dry completely and reinstalled according to the brand’s procedure.

If you drive in dusty, off-road or high-pollen environments, inspect more frequently and err on the side of earlier service.
